The surface area of a cone is the area which covers the outer surface of the cone. The surface area (total surface area) of a cone is the entire space occupied by the flat circular base of the cone and its curved surface. The total surface area will be equal to the sum of its curved surface area and circular base area. Find the surface area of a cone using its formula. The formula that is used to calculate the total surface area of a cone is, tsa of cone = πr(r + l), where the radius of the base of the cone is 'r' and the slant height of the cone is 'l'.
